Базовые понятия HTML и CSS для стартующих
Базовые понятия HTML и CSS для стартующих
Построение сайтов берёт начало с изучения двух основных технологий. HTML отвечает за построение и наполнение страниц. CSS контролирует внешним дизайном элементов.
Разработчики используют HTML для вставки текста, иллюстраций, ссылок и других элементов. CSS позволяет устанавливать оттенки, шрифты, размеры и размещение контейнеров. Эти языки функционируют вместе и дополняются друг друга.
Освоение казино вулкан предоставляет путь к сфере веб-разработчика. Знание базовых правил позволяет разрабатывать функциональные и приятные интернет-ресурсы. Начинающие разработчики могут быстро приобрести прикладные навыки и задействовать их в реальных работах.
Что такое HTML и зачем он требуется сайту
HTML интерпретируется как HyperText Markup Language. Язык разметки задаёт структуру веб-документов и структурирует содержимое страниц. Браузеры читают HTML-код и выводят контент в понятном для посетителей виде.
Каждый элемент страницы задаётся специальными командами. Названия, параграфы, списки, таблицы и формы создаются с посредством тегов. Теги представляют собой директивы, помещённые в угловые скобки. Браузер читает эти инструкции и генерирует графическое отображение содержимого.
Без HTML нельзя создать Вулкан казино любого рода. Язык разметки служит основанием для всех порталов. Поисковые системы обрабатывают HTML-структуру для каталогизации веб-страниц. Правильная структура улучшает места сайта в результатах запроса.
HTML непрерывно совершенствуется и приобретает новые опции. Актуальная версия HTML5 поддерживает видео, аудио и интерактивные компоненты. Программисты могут встраивать мультимедийный контент без дополнительных модулей. Смысловые теги способствуют Вулкан лучше понимать функцию разных секций страницы.
Базовые метки и структура веб-страницы
Любой HTML-документ содержит ясную иерархическую организацию. Основной блок html включает всё наполнение страницы. Внутри располагаются два основных раздела: head и body.
Блок head хранит вспомогательную данные о документе. Здесь задаётся титул веб-страницы, присоединяются стили и скрипты. Посетители не видят содержимое этого блока непосредственно. Блок body содержит весь доступный содержимое.
Для упорядочивания содержимого используются разнообразные теги:
- h1-h6 создают титулы разнообразных степеней
- p оформляет текстовые параграфы
- a формирует ссылки на другие страницы
- img встраивает картинки в файл
- ul и ol формируют маркированные и нумерованные перечни
- table упорядочивает данные в табличном формате
Семантические элементы делают структуру более доступной. Тег header определяет верхнюю часть сайта. Элемент nav группирует навигационные гиперссылки. Блок main содержит основное контент страницы. Footer размещается в нижней зоне и содержит контактную данные.
Грамотная структура страницы важна для доступности. Программы чтения с экрана применяют казино Вулкан для перемещения по веб-странице. Структурированная компоновка компонентов улучшает понимание данных всеми группами пользователей. Соответствующий скрипт действует корректно во всех новых обозревателях.
Как CSS отвечает за внешний оформление сайта
C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ей определяют зрительное отображение HTML-элементов. Инструмент разделяет дизайн от структуры страницы.
Без стилей все сайты смотрятся однообразно. Браузер показывает текст чёрным тоном на белом фоновом цвете. Титулы приобретают стандартные величины. CSS помогает модифицировать каждый аспект внешнего вида.
Стили можно подключить тремя вариантами. Внешний файл присоединяется с HTML-документом через тег link. Внутренние стили помещаются в теге style. Встроенные стили указываются в свойстве тега.
Каскадность подразумевает иерархию действия правил. Inline стили обладают высший приоритет. Внутренние стили перекрывают отдельные. Браузер использует самое специфичное инструкцию к каждому компоненту.
CSS регулирует всеми зрительными характеристиками. Разработчики задают оттенки подложки и текста. Стили изменяют размеры, отступы и границы контейнеров. Новейший Вулкан казино применяет анимации и переходы для создания интерактивных эффектов.
Селекторы, свойства и значения в CSS
Инструкция CSS состоит из трёх частей. Селектор обозначает тег для оформления. Параметр определяет особенность дизайна. Значение задаёт определённый значение.
Селекторы отбирают теги по разнообразным критериям. Селектор тега использует стили ко всем компонентам определённого типа. Селектор класса взаимодействует с свойством class. Селектор идентификатора отбирает индивидуальный тег по атрибуту id.
Комбинированные селекторы генерируют более точные инструкции. Селектор потомка выбирает внутренние элементы. Селектор непосредственного компонента действует только с непосредственными потомками. Псевдоклассы применяют стили при конкретных условиях.
Параметры описывают различные аспекты оформления. Свойства color и background-color контролируют цветовой схемой. Параметры width и height задают размеры. Атрибуты margin и padding управляют отступы.
Значения указываются в разнообразных вариантах. Оттенки указываются в шестнадцатеричном виде, RGB или именами. Величины определяются в пикселях, процентах или пропорциональных величинах. Корректное использование селекторов позволяет Вулкан продуктивно регулировать стилизацией совокупности элементов.
Работа с цветами, гарнитурами и полями
Цветовое оформление генерирует визуальную атмосферу страницы. Атрибут color модифицирует цвет текста. Атрибут background-color определяет подложку компонента. Тона прописываются несколькими способами: названиями, шестнадцатеричными обозначениями или значениями RGB.
Шестнадцатеричный тип стартует с знака хеша. Код состоит из шести элементов, определяющих красный, зелёный и синий каналы. Тип RGB задействует числовые величины от 0 до 255 для каждого компонента. Вид RGBA добавляет характеристику непрозрачности.
Оформление текста сказывается на восприятие контента. Свойство font-family устанавливает семейство шрифта. Атрибут font-size задаёт размер символов. Параметр font-weight управляет насыщенность шрифта. Параметр line-height устанавливает межстрочный интервал.
Системные шрифты имеются на всех платформах. Онлайн-шрифты подгружаются с сторонних серверов. Сервис Google Fonts обеспечивает безвозмездную библиотеку гарнитур. Разработчики задают несколько гарнитур в очерёдности приоритета.
Отступы создают место около элементов. Параметр margin формирует внешние интервалы между контейнерами. Параметр padding создаёт внутренние отступы от рамок до наполнения. Поля можно задавать для каждой стороны отдельно или одним числом одновременно для всех краёв. Грамотное использование казино Вулкан усиливает графическую иерархию и понимание информации.
Блочная схема и расположение компонентов
Блочная концепция описывает архитектуру каждого HTML-элемента. Концепция состоит из четырёх зон: содержимого, внутреннего интервала, рамки и внешнего поля. Понимание этой принципа необходимо для точного регулирования размерами.
Зона содержимого содержит текст и иллюстрации. Внутренний интервал padding создаёт место между содержимым и краем. Рамка border окружает блок заметной линией. Внешний отступ margin формирует расстояние до прилегающих контейнеров.
Свойство box-sizing изменяет подсчёт величин. Вариант content-box учитывает только контент. Вариант border-box добавляет padding и border в общую ширину.
Свойство display устанавливает тип визуализации. Блочные блоки захватывают всю доступную ширину. Инлайновые элементы находятся в одной линии. Значение inline-block совмещает характеристики обоих видов.
Параметр position управляет позиционированием. Параметр relative смещает компонент относительно первоначального позиции. Absolute позиционирует элемент относительно вышестоящего элемента. Актуальный Вулкан казино задействует Flexbox и Grid для формирования многоуровневых компоновок.
Гибкая разработка для различных платформ
Отзывчивая верстка предоставляет правильное отображение сайта на всех дисплеях. Пользователи посещают на сайты с компьютеров, планшетов и телефонов. Макет призван настраиваться под габарит экрана автоматически.
Медиазапросы задействуют стили в зависимости от характеристик платформы. Инструкция @media проверяет ширину экрана и другие параметры. Разработчики генерируют отдельные наборы стилей для разнообразных интервалов габаритов.
Метод mobile-first начинает разработку с версии для мобильных устройств. Основные стили описывают оформление для маленьких дисплеев. Медиазапросы вносят дополнения для больших экранов.
Эластичные сетки задействуют относительные величины измерения. Ширина элементов устанавливается в процентах вместо фиксированных пикселей. Flexbox и Grid генерируют гибкие компоновки без комплексных расчётов.
Иллюстрации нуждаются особого учёта при оптимизации. Свойство max-width со параметром 100% исключает выход изображений за пределы блока. Атрибут srcset скачивает картинки разного качества. Правильная реализация казино Вулкан улучшает пользовательский впечатление на всех категориях платформ.
Типичные ошибки стартующих при взаимодействии с HTML и CSS
Новички разработчики делают стандартные промахи при разработке веб-страниц. Осознание типичных ошибок помогает избежать их в своих работах. Устранение промахов на начальных стадиях сберегает время и повышает качество программы.
Ключевые ошибки при взаимодействии с структурой и стилями:
- Открытые теги ломают организацию документа и ведут к неправильному визуализации
- Задействование старых тегов вместо новых смысловых тегов
- Отсутствие описательного текста для иллюстраций снижает доступность материала
- Инлайновые стили в HTML затрудняют обслуживание и корректировку стилизации
- Ошибочная вложенность тегов вызывает конфликты в структуре
- Избыточное использование идентификаторов вместо классов сужает повторное использование стилей
Проблемы с CSS также встречаются регулярно. Стартующие упускают прописывать величины измерения для цифровых значений. Излишне точные селекторы затрудняют изменение стилей. Отсутствие сброса стилей браузера создаёт расхождения в отображении на разных системах.
Пренебрежение кроссбраузерной согласованности приводит к сложностям. Страница может отлично отображаться в одном обозревателе и неправильно в втором. Проверка кода посредством специальные инструменты выявляет синтаксические недочёты. Постоянная контроль способствует Вулкан сохранять превосходное уровень программирования и соответствие стандартам.
Responses